Core Payroll and Tax Functions

Both Gusto and SurePayroll boast robust payroll capabilities. With Gusto, you enjoy full-service payroll that includes tax filing, tax payments, and automated tax calculations for federal, state, and local payroll taxes. Their Full-Service plan offers comprehensive tax registration, tax filings, and even support for Social Security with minimal data entry. SurePayroll, on the other hand, provides a more budget-friendly option through its “No Tax Filing” plan and additional add-on costs for local filing and multi-state tax registration.

Pricing and Extra Costs

When making an informed decision, it’s essential to compare pricing plans and extra cost considerations. Gusto’s pricing structures are transparent, with a generous two-month free trial available, ensuring you can test their extensive features—from advanced HR features to payroll tax filings—before committing. SurePayroll, while offering a more affordable starting price, may incur additional costs for add-on services such as local tax filing, time tracking integrations, and accounting software integrations.
